Standing proudly at an elevation of over 1,400 meters, Torna Fort is not only one of the highest forts in Maharashtra but also one of the most significant. Known as the first fort captured by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j at the age of 16, Torna marks the beginning of a legacy that would change Indian history.

For trekkers, it offers a perfect combination of challenge, heritage, and breathtaking Sahyadri landscapes.

Why Torna Fort Is Worth Exploring

Torna Fort, also known as Prachandagad, translates to "Massive Fort"—a name that feels entirely appropriate when you stand before its imposing ridges and expansive fortifications.

Unlike beginner-friendly treks, Torna demands a little more effort. The climb is longer, steeper, and more physically demanding.

But with that effort comes one of the most rewarding trekking experiences in Maharashtra.

From sweeping mountain views to ancient structures hidden along the trail, Torna constantly reminds you why the journey is worth it.

Trek Overview

Location: Near Velhe, Maharashtra

Difficulty: Moderate to Difficult

Duration: 5–7 Hours

Best Season: June to February

Ideal For: Experienced trekkers, history enthusiasts, adventure seekers

Monsoon brings lush greenery and dramatic clouds, while winter offers pleasant temperatures and clear views across the Sahyadri range.

What to Expect on the Trail

The trek begins from Velhe village and gradually ascends through open terrain before becoming steeper as you approach the fort.

As elevation increases, the landscape becomes more dramatic.

You'll encounter:

  • Rocky mountain sections

  • Narrow ridges

  • Historic fort walls

  • Ancient gateways

  • Panoramic viewpoints

The fort itself is vast, giving trekkers plenty to explore after reaching the summit.

One of the highlights is witnessing the immense scale of the fort while overlooking neighboring peaks and valleys stretching into the distance.

What to Pack for Torna

A trek of this nature requires preparation.

Carry:

  • Water (2–3 litres minimum)

  • Energy bars and snacks

  • Trekking shoes with strong grip

  • Cap and sunglasses

  • First-aid kit

  • Power bank

  • A lightweight trekking jacket

The exposed sections near the top can become windy, especially during mornings and evenings.

Trail Tips

  • Begin early to avoid trekking during the hottest part of the day.

  • Carry enough water for the entire climb.

  • Maintain a steady pace instead of rushing.

  • Wear shoes designed for uneven terrain.

  • Allocate extra time to explore the fort after reaching the top.

Torna rewards those who take their time.
